nCino offers exciting career opportunities for individuals who want to join the worldwide leader in cloud banking.

As the Senior Knowledge and Content Specialist, you will be an integral part of the People Operations Learning & Enablement Team, directly impacting the delivery of learning content across the company. This role will be the primary custodian of end user facing documentation. applying their skills in a collaborative environment by partnering with experienced colleagues, and contributing to the company's success through effective content management, curation, and development.

  • Develop and maintain a centralized content hub to assist in facilitation of knowledge sharing and the resources supporting it.
  • Define processes and best practice standards to manage knowledge assets with company-wide stakeholders ensuring alignment and adherence to established standards, processes and guidelines
  • Train and educate front-end users on the knowledge management tools and processes; creating the content to achieve this as needed
  • Promote and monitor collaborative tools to facilitate sharing of ideas and work among internal teams
  • Proactively maintain the portfolio of enablement content, identify areas that require updates or maintenance due to impactful changes, and ensure awareness of maintenance needs to the appropriate stakeholders
  • Periodically engage in content creation activities, such as video editing and graphic design, to support high-quality content development across the company in alignment with the centralized guidelines
Requirements:
  • Bachelor's degree
  • Minimum of five (5) years of experience as a Knowledge Management Specialist
  • Coordination efforts to mainstream knowledge management into core activities and projects
  • Ability to independently build partnerships, and promote initiatives to identify, create and share knowledge
  • Experience using Microsoft products, O365, Sharepoint or similar software
  • Instructional design graphics experience o Experience with video or graphic design editing tools
  • Experience writing and creating content
  • Project Management experience
Desired:
  • Information Systems, Knowledge Management, Business degree
  • Camtasia, Canva, or similar software
  • Knowledge of the Salesforce platform
  • Banking industry knowledge
  • Experience in the software industry
